get_facility_risk_delta
Shows how a facility's market risk has changed recently using DCPI health delta over a user-defined period.
Instructions
Use when a user asks what has CHANGED in a facility's (or its market's) risk profile recently — "has this site gotten riskier lately?", "which way is this market moving?" — a temporal question static-trained models can't answer. Returns the REAL DCPI market-health delta (excess-power score change over the window, direction improving/worsening/flat) from DC Hub's history-preserving daily snapshots. INTEGRITY: only DCPI market-health has a short-term temporal series; the site-hazard dimensions (FEMA disaster / USGS seismic / NOAA climate / WRI water) are DECLARED static (they don't change week-to-week) with a pointer to the point-in-time tool — never a fabricated week-over-week delta; no snapshot history → coverage:unavailable. Params: facility_id (a discovered-facility id or slug) OR market (a market name/slug), since (e.g. "7d"/"30d", default 7d). Returns {facility, dcpi_market_health:{delta, now, direction, coverage}, static_dimensions{...}, summary}. For the current point-in-time risk (not the change) use get_composite_site_score / get_disaster_risk / get_climate_intel.
